Raymond James Coxon was a versatile artist born in Hanley, Stoke-on-Trent, Staffordshire. He served in the Cavalry in Palestine during World War I before studying at Leeds College of Art and the Royal College of Art. Coxon was known for his work as a painter, mural artist, and printmaker. He was associated with prominent artists like Henry Moore and Jacob Epstein, forming the British Independent Society in 1927. Coxon also taught at Richmond School of Art and exhibited at various galleries in London. He later became an Official War Artist during World War II and had a joint show with his wife, artist Edna Ginesi, in 1985.
